Renegade Kid now has the rights for the Dementium series

Sequels may be on the way

Recommended Videos

Did you like the Dementium series on the Nintendo DS? Well there’s a reason why developer Renegade Kid couldn’t create more games in the franchise — they didn’t have the rights. After a long wait, Renegade’s Jools Watsham announced that they now have the rights back, and that Dementium sequels aren’t tied up with the previous publisher anymore.

There aren’t nearly enough horror games on the 3DS, so I hope that if games are coming at some point (nothing is confirmed), they deliver.
